Collingwood Delists Markov, Macrae, Johnson and Dean After Prelim Exit

List boss Justin Leppitsch framed the decision as routine post-season management, thanking the quartet for their contributions.

Overview

  • Oleg Markov, a 2023 premiership defender who played 43 games for Collingwood, was among the four players cut.
  • Former first-round pick Fin Macrae departs after 21 senior games and no AFL appearances in 2025.
  • Ash Johnson was delisted after missing most of this season with a broken leg suffered in a VFL pre-season game.
  • Defender Charlie Dean leaves the club with 12 AFL games to his name.
  • The moves follow Collingwood’s preliminary final loss to Brisbane and add to the earlier retirement of Will Hoskin-Elliott.
